// SPDX-FileCopyrightText: Copyright The Miniflux Authors. All rights reserved.
// SPDX-License-Identifier: Apache-2.0
package model // import "miniflux.app/v2/internal/model"
import (
"time"
)
// Entry statuses and default sorting order.
const (
EntryStatusUnread = "unread"
EntryStatusRead = "read"
EntryStatusRemoved = "removed"
DefaultSortingOrder = "published_at"
DefaultSortingDirection = "asc"
)
// Entry represents a feed item in the system.
type Entry struct {
ID int64 `json:"id"`
UserID int64 `json:"user_id"`
FeedID int64 `json:"feed_id"`
Status string `json:"status"`
Hash string `json:"hash"`
Title string `json:"title"`
URL string `json:"url"`
CommentsURL string `json:"comments_url"`
Date time.Time `json:"published_at"`
CreatedAt time.Time `json:"created_at"`
ChangedAt time.Time `json:"changed_at"`
Content string `json:"content"`
Author string `json:"author"`
ShareCode string `json:"share_code"`
Starred bool `json:"starred"`
ReadingTime int `json:"reading_time"`
Enclosures EnclosureList `json:"enclosures"`
Feed *Feed `json:"feed,omitempty"`
Tags []string `json:"tags"`
}
func NewEntry() *Entry {
return &Entry{
Enclosures: make(EnclosureList, 0),
Tags: make([]string, 0),
Feed: &Feed{
Category: &Category{},
Icon: &FeedIcon{},
},
}
}
// ShouldMarkAsReadOnView Return whether the entry should be marked as viewed considering all user settings and entry state.
func (e *Entry) ShouldMarkAsReadOnView(user *User) bool {
// Already read, no need to mark as read again. Removed entries are not marked as read
if e.Status != EntryStatusUnread {
return false
}
// There is an enclosure, markAsRead will happen at enclosure completion time, no need to mark as read on view
if user.MarkReadOnMediaPlayerCompletion && e.Enclosures.ContainsAudioOrVideo() {
return false
}
// The user wants to mark as read on view
return user.MarkReadOnView
}
// Entries represents a list of entries.
type Entries []*Entry
// EntriesStatusUpdateRequest represents a request to change entries status.
type EntriesStatusUpdateRequest struct {
EntryIDs []int64 `json:"entry_ids"`
Status string `json:"status"`
}
// EntryUpdateRequest represents a request to update an entry.
type EntryUpdateRequest struct {
Title *string `json:"title"`
Content *string `json:"content"`
}
func (e *EntryUpdateRequest) Patch(entry *Entry) {
if e.Title != nil && *e.Title != "" {
entry.Title = *e.Title
}
if e.Content != nil && *e.Content != "" {
entry.Content = *e.Content
}
}
